    Make sure you update SpyBot and Ad-ware to the latest versions and scan again. You might want to disconnect from the internet and turn off 'Restore' in XP also, to keep them from reloading again.

    In your task manager are your referring to the Japanese? characters? Everything else seems normal to me, anyway.

    There are a couple of trojans that can disable both antivirus and software firewalls. I've had it happen myself.

    You might also go to TrendMicro and use their free scan http://housecall.trendmicro.com/ and see if they can find anything.

    Lastly, if all else fails, run regedit and search for those processes names and see if you can find them. Just be careful about deleting things there. Backup the registry first.
